MBJ Will Hold a Meeting Every Quarter to Enhance Effectiveness

Mesyuarat Pemantauan Majlis Bersama Jabatan (MBJ) at Sarawak State level had held it inaugural meeting last March. The meeting then will be held quarterly to enhance the effectiveness of MBJ in Sarawak.

This meeting also double-act as a forum for the government agencies in the State to get clarification regarding the issues faced by MBJ. YBhg Datu Abdul Ghafur Shariff, Director of Human Resource Management Unit in Chief Minister’s Department had chaired the meeting. Permanent Secretaries, Residents and Head of Departments attended the meeting.

According to Datu Abdul Ghafur, Sarawak has been a role model for the other states following the success of establishing MBJ in every state agency. The success lead to the invitation for the Sarawak State Government to brief on the progress and achievement of MBJ in the state at the Mesyuarat Pemantauan MBJ National level that was held in Tawau, Sabah last February.

To appreciate their effort and to enhance the progress of MBJ in all agencies in Malaysia, the JPA has award the appreciation certificate to every MBJ that succeed in holding the full meeting starting this year.

All 11 MBJ in Sarawak has been honoured to receive the certificate at the end of the meeting.

~INFO~

a. Issues that arose by every MBJ agency will be forward by JPA to the Prime Minister’s Office.

b. At State level, the briefing to MMKN will be held yearly to inform the progress of MBJ in Sarawak.

c. Starting this year, the MBJ report will be forward in Permanant Secretaries/Residents Meeting every quarter.

d. Clause 5 of MBJ Constitution stated that the membership from the employee is valid for two years starting form the date of appointment and re-election
must be held after the said period.

e. All agencies need to hold MBJ meeting every quarter and to forward the minutes of meeting to JPA not later than two weeks.

f. For monitoring purpose, all agencies must send the schedule of meeting according to quarterly event to Human Resource Management Unit
